Use same style as other [] options
This commit is contained in:
parent
543072ab37
commit
6bae48431c
54
abra
54
abra
@ -11,7 +11,7 @@ DOC="
|
|||||||
The cooperative cloud utility belt 🎩🐇
|
The cooperative cloud utility belt 🎩🐇
|
||||||
|
|
||||||
Usage:
|
Usage:
|
||||||
abra [options] app new [--server=<server> --domain=<domain> --pass] <app>
|
abra [options] app new [--server=<server>] [--domain=<domain>] [--pass] <app>
|
||||||
abra [options] app (list|ls)
|
abra [options] app (list|ls)
|
||||||
abra [options] app <domain> deploy
|
abra [options] app <domain> deploy
|
||||||
abra [options] app <domain> undeploy
|
abra [options] app <domain> undeploy
|
||||||
@ -142,8 +142,8 @@ eval "var_$1+=($value)"; else eval "var_$1=$value"; fi; return 0; fi; done
|
|||||||
return 1; }; stdout() { printf -- "cat <<'EOM'\n%s\nEOM\n" "$1"; }; stderr() {
|
return 1; }; stdout() { printf -- "cat <<'EOM'\n%s\nEOM\n" "$1"; }; stderr() {
|
||||||
printf -- "cat <<'EOM' >&2\n%s\nEOM\n" "$1"; }; error() {
|
printf -- "cat <<'EOM' >&2\n%s\nEOM\n" "$1"; }; error() {
|
||||||
[[ -n $1 ]] && stderr "$1"; stderr "$usage"; _return 1; }; _return() {
|
[[ -n $1 ]] && stderr "$1"; stderr "$usage"; _return 1; }; _return() {
|
||||||
printf -- "exit %d\n" "$1"; exit "$1"; }; set -e; trimmed_doc=${DOC:1:1384}
|
printf -- "exit %d\n" "$1"; exit "$1"; }; set -e; trimmed_doc=${DOC:1:1388}
|
||||||
usage=${DOC:40:1076}; digest=c5735; shorts=(-e -s -v -h '' '' '' '' '' '')
|
usage=${DOC:40:1080}; digest=112a7; shorts=(-e -s -v -h '' '' '' '' '' '')
|
||||||
longs=(--env --stack --version --help --server --domain --pass --force --user --all)
|
longs=(--env --stack --version --help --server --domain --pass --force --user --all)
|
||||||
argcounts=(1 1 0 0 1 1 0 0 1 0); node_0(){ value __env 0; }; node_1(){
|
argcounts=(1 1 0 0 1 1 0 0 1 0); node_0(){ value __env 0; }; node_1(){
|
||||||
value __stack 1; }; node_2(){ switch __version 2; }; node_3(){ switch __help 3
|
value __stack 1; }; node_2(){ switch __version 2; }; node_3(){ switch __help 3
|
||||||
@ -164,29 +164,29 @@ node_37(){ _command secret; }; node_38(){ _command auto; }; node_39(){
|
|||||||
_command generate; }; node_40(){ _command insert; }; node_41(){ _command server
|
_command generate; }; node_40(){ _command insert; }; node_41(){ _command server
|
||||||
}; node_42(){ _command add; }; node_43(){ _command use; }; node_44(){
|
}; node_42(){ _command add; }; node_43(){ _command use; }; node_44(){
|
||||||
_command init; }; node_45(){ _command upgrade; }; node_46(){ optional 0 1 2 3; }
|
_command init; }; node_45(){ _command upgrade; }; node_46(){ optional 0 1 2 3; }
|
||||||
node_47(){ optional 46; }; node_48(){ optional 4 5 6; }; node_49(){
|
node_47(){ optional 46; }; node_48(){ optional 4; }; node_49(){ optional 5; }
|
||||||
required 47 24 25 48 10; }; node_50(){ either 26 27; }; node_51(){ required 50
|
node_50(){ optional 6; }; node_51(){ required 47 24 25 48 49 50 10; }
|
||||||
}; node_52(){ required 47 24 51; }; node_53(){ required 47 24 11 28; }
|
node_52(){ either 26 27; }; node_53(){ required 52; }; node_54(){
|
||||||
node_54(){ required 47 24 11 29; }; node_55(){ required 47 24 11 30; }
|
required 47 24 53; }; node_55(){ required 47 24 11 28; }; node_56(){
|
||||||
node_56(){ either 31 32; }; node_57(){ required 56; }; node_58(){ optional 7; }
|
required 47 24 11 29; }; node_57(){ required 47 24 11 30; }; node_58(){
|
||||||
node_59(){ required 47 24 11 57 58; }; node_60(){ optional 12; }; node_61(){
|
either 31 32; }; node_59(){ required 58; }; node_60(){ optional 7; }; node_61(){
|
||||||
required 47 24 11 33 60; }; node_62(){ required 47 24 11 34; }; node_63(){
|
required 47 24 11 59 60; }; node_62(){ optional 12; }; node_63(){
|
||||||
required 47 24 11 35 13 14; }; node_64(){ optional 8; }; node_65(){ oneormore 15
|
required 47 24 11 33 62; }; node_64(){ required 47 24 11 34; }; node_65(){
|
||||||
}; node_66(){ required 47 24 11 36 64 12 65; }; node_67(){
|
required 47 24 11 35 13 14; }; node_66(){ optional 8; }; node_67(){ oneormore 15
|
||||||
required 47 24 11 36 12 65; }; node_68(){ required 47 24 11 37 38; }; node_69(){
|
}; node_68(){ required 47 24 11 36 66 12 67; }; node_69(){
|
||||||
optional 18; }; node_70(){ optional 6; }; node_71(){
|
required 47 24 11 36 12 67; }; node_70(){ required 47 24 11 37 38; }; node_71(){
|
||||||
required 47 24 11 37 39 16 17 69 70; }; node_72(){
|
optional 18; }; node_72(){ required 47 24 11 37 39 16 17 71 50; }; node_73(){
|
||||||
required 47 24 11 37 40 16 17 19 70; }; node_73(){ either 16 9; }; node_74(){
|
required 47 24 11 37 40 16 17 19 50; }; node_74(){ either 16 9; }; node_75(){
|
||||||
required 73; }; node_75(){ optional 6 7; }; node_76(){
|
required 74; }; node_76(){ optional 6 7; }; node_77(){
|
||||||
required 47 24 11 37 57 74 75; }; node_77(){ optional 21; }; node_78(){
|
required 47 24 11 37 59 75 76; }; node_78(){ optional 21; }; node_79(){
|
||||||
optional 22; }; node_79(){ required 47 41 42 20 77 78; }; node_80(){
|
optional 22; }; node_80(){ required 47 41 42 20 78 79; }; node_81(){
|
||||||
required 47 41 51; }; node_81(){ required 47 41 32 20; }; node_82(){
|
required 47 41 53; }; node_82(){ required 47 41 32 20; }; node_83(){
|
||||||
required 47 41 43 20; }; node_83(){ required 47 41 44 20; }; node_84(){
|
required 47 41 43 20; }; node_84(){ required 47 41 44 20; }; node_85(){
|
||||||
required 47 45; }; node_85(){ optional 65; }; node_86(){ required 47 23 85; }
|
required 47 45; }; node_86(){ optional 67; }; node_87(){ required 47 23 86; }
|
||||||
node_87(){
|
node_88(){
|
||||||
either 49 52 53 54 55 59 61 62 63 66 67 68 71 72 76 79 80 81 82 83 84 86; }
|
either 51 54 55 56 57 61 63 64 65 68 69 70 72 73 77 80 81 82 83 84 85 87; }
|
||||||
node_88(){ required 87; }; cat <<<' docopt_exit() {
|
node_89(){ required 88; }; cat <<<' docopt_exit() {
|
||||||
[[ -n $1 ]] && printf "%s\n" "$1" >&2; printf "%s\n" "${DOC:40:1076}" >&2
|
[[ -n $1 ]] && printf "%s\n" "$1" >&2; printf "%s\n" "${DOC:40:1080}" >&2
|
||||||
exit 1; }'; unset var___env var___stack var___version var___help var___server \
|
exit 1; }'; unset var___env var___stack var___version var___help var___server \
|
||||||
var___domain var___pass var___force var___user var___all var__app_ \
|
var___domain var___pass var___force var___user var___all var__app_ \
|
||||||
var__domain_ var__service_ var__src_ var__dst_ var__args_ var__secret_ \
|
var__domain_ var__service_ var__src_ var__dst_ var__args_ var__secret_ \
|
||||||
@ -194,7 +194,7 @@ var__version_ var__cmd_ var__data_ var__host_ var__user_ var__port_ \
|
|||||||
var__command_ var_app var_new var_list var_ls var_deploy var_undeploy \
|
var__command_ var_app var_new var_list var_ls var_deploy var_undeploy \
|
||||||
var_config var_delete var_rm var_logs var_multilogs var_cp var_run var_secret \
|
var_config var_delete var_rm var_logs var_multilogs var_cp var_run var_secret \
|
||||||
var_auto var_generate var_insert var_server var_add var_use var_init var_upgrade
|
var_auto var_generate var_insert var_server var_add var_use var_init var_upgrade
|
||||||
parse 88 "$@"; local prefix=${DOCOPT_PREFIX:-''}; unset "${prefix}__env" \
|
parse 89 "$@"; local prefix=${DOCOPT_PREFIX:-''}; unset "${prefix}__env" \
|
||||||
"${prefix}__stack" "${prefix}__version" "${prefix}__help" "${prefix}__server" \
|
"${prefix}__stack" "${prefix}__version" "${prefix}__help" "${prefix}__server" \
|
||||||
"${prefix}__domain" "${prefix}__pass" "${prefix}__force" "${prefix}__user" \
|
"${prefix}__domain" "${prefix}__pass" "${prefix}__force" "${prefix}__user" \
|
||||||
"${prefix}__all" "${prefix}_app_" "${prefix}_domain_" "${prefix}_service_" \
|
"${prefix}__all" "${prefix}_app_" "${prefix}_domain_" "${prefix}_service_" \
|
||||||
|
Loading…
Reference in New Issue
Block a user